  • Synthesis of 2-amino-5-(5R-1,2,4-oxadiazolyl-3)-1,3,4-oxadiazoles
    作者:V. N. Yarovenko、O. V. Lysenko、M. M. Krayushkin
    DOI:10.1007/bf00698886
    日期:1993.12
    The interaction of 2-amino-1,3,4-oxadiazole-5-carboxamidoxime with nitriles in the presence of ZnCl2 and HC1 or with trichloroacetic anhydride affords 2-amino-5-(5R-1,2,4-oxadiazolyl-3)-1,3,4-oxadiazoles. Their reactions with N-nucleophiles have been studied.

  • Synthesis of 2-amino-5-cyano-1,3,4-oxadiazole and some of its derivatives
    作者:F. M. Stoyanovich、E. P. Zakharov、O. V. Lysenko、V. N. Yarovenko、M. M. Krayushkin
    DOI:10.1007/bf00959674
    日期:1991.1
    Preparative syntheses have been developed for 2-amino-5-cyano-1,3,4-oxadiazole from the semicarbazone of methyl glyoxylate and some of its transformations were studied. This product is an important intermediate in the preparation of its derivatives.
